49ers rookie DE Mikail Kamara carted off practice field with apparent knee injury

San Francisco 49ers rookie DE Mikail Kamara was carted off the practice field with an apparent knee injury.

Scoring Zone's Take

Mikail Kamara's rookie campaign hit a red flag before it even started — the 49ers DE was carted off the practice field with an apparent knee injury, per both sources. There's no word yet on severity, so treat this as a wait-and-see situation rather than a confirmed long-term absence. A cart-off is never a good sign, but until San Francisco or the medical staff clarifies whether this is a sprain, a torn ligament, or something in between, it's premature to write him off entirely.

For fantasy purposes, Kamara was already a deep-league or dynasty-only stash given he's a rookie defensive end unlikely to carry standalone value in most standard formats — IDP leagues being the exception where his snap count and role were worth monitoring in camp. This injury is a real ding to his rookie-year outlook regardless of format: lost practice reps in August are costly for any first-year player trying to carve out a role, and a significant knee injury could threaten his entire season before it begins.

Action item: if you're in an IDP league where Kamara was on your radar as a late-round dev stash, pause any add plans until there's clarity on the diagnosis. Don't drop him yet if you already have him rostered in a devy/dynasty format — rookie knee injuries in practice can range from minor to season-ending, and cutting bait now without more information would be premature. In standard redraft leagues, this news is largely moot since he wasn't draftable value anyway. Confidence in the injury occurring is high, but confidence in fantasy impact is low until more details on severity emerge.
